We are performing Slipping Through My Fingers at the Brighton Fringe 2025. This play is a semi-autobiographical piece based on my family's experience with my Nana Aileen's Alzheimer's.
Alongside this performance raising awareness I wanted to be able to raise some money for research into a cure.
